Two highly trained operatives (Miles Teller and Anya Taylor-Joy) are assigned to guard towers on opposite sides of a vast and highly secretive canyon, protecting the world from an undisclosed, mysterious evil lurking within. They bond from afar while trying to remain vigilant in their defense against an unseen enemy. …
Leave A Comment